The Museum Of Military Medicine Trust

Also known as: Army Medical Sercvices Museum, Museum of Military Medicine

Inform and encourage the engagement of the public and armed forces personnel, including members of the Army Medical Services (AMS), in the role of the AMS in pioneering medical developments and innovations, in particular those that have subsequently been adopted into civilian healthcare practice, to the benefit of the health and wellbeing of the British public at large and humankind in general.

When was The Museum Of Military Medicine Trust registered as a charity?

The Museum Of Military Medicine Trust was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 6 January 2017 as charity number 1171026. It has been registered for 9 years.

Who runs The Museum Of Military Medicine Trust?

The Museum Of Military Medicine Trust is governed by a board of 9 trustees. The chair of trustees is Dr Alan Hawley.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.
